1973 Ferrari 365 BB vs. 1999 Renault Megane

To start off, 1999 Renault Megane is newer by 26 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1973 Ferrari 365 BB.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1973 Ferrari 365 BB would be higher. At 4,388 cc, 1973 Ferrari 365 BB is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1973 Ferrari 365 BB (380 HP @ 7500 RPM) has 283 more horse power than 1999 Renault Megane. (97 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1973 Ferrari 365 BB should accelerate faster than 1999 Renault Megane.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1973 Ferrari 365 BB weights approximately 25 kg more than 1999 Renault Megane.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1973 Ferrari 365 BB is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1973 Ferrari 365 BB.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1999 Renault Megane,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1973 Ferrari 365 BB (410 Nm) has 283 more torque (in Nm) than 1999 Renault Megane. (127 Nm). This means 1973 Ferrari 365 BB will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1999 Renault Megane.
